How Can You Protect Your Rights After Being Injured In A Motorcycle Crash? Find Out

If you're knocked down by a motorist when riding your motorcycle, your injuries can change your life forever. Luckily, you can mitigate the impact the crash may have on your life if you get compensation to cover all your losses. However, your success will depend on the measures you take immediately after the collision.  Even the slightest mistake when preparing your claim or handling the compensation process could make you lose the entitled payments. On the other hand, taking the following steps will enable you to protect your rights and increase your chances of getting justice.

Check on the Possible Injuries

If you're accidentally knocked down when riding a motorbike, move to the side of the road and check your injuries. There is a possibility that you may not feel any pain after the accident because of the shock and adrenaline rushing through your body. Therefore, you should not assume you are fine if none of your body parts are aching. Getting a thorough medical examination and treatment for your injuries is imperative. Doing so protects your rights because the medical reports you get will be helpful when preparing your claim. It would help if you also preserved all your receipts after the medical services for accident-related injuries. In addition, you need to follow the doctor's guidelines until you recover.

Gather and Preserve All the Evidence You Can

Gather and preserve all the evidence you can, including pictures of the crash scene and your damaged bike. Then, move around the area and gather any other useful information you can access. It may include the name of the people involved in the crash, the contact information of pedestrians, and witnesses who may be willing to testify for you. Finally, you need to check the nearby shops or restaurants to determine whether there are cameras that could have captured the accident. If there are, request the business owners to give you the video footage.
